dots dots

ChatGPT en desarrollo y programación

por Jorge Hernández

En los últimos meses, ha habido un creciente interés en el tema de la inteligencia artificial y su potencial para transformar diversas industrias. Sin embargo, pocos han explorado cómo podemos aprovechar al máximo esta tecnología para mejorar nuestras tareas laborales sin necesariamente reemplazar a los trabajadores. En este contexto, profundizaremos en el papel de ChatGPT, uno de los sistemas más destacados en el campo de la inteligencia artificial.
¿Cómo contribuye ChatGPT al desarrollo y la programación?

  • Generación de código: Si bien esta herramienta es capaz de generar código desde cero, es importante destacar que no siempre se adapta perfectamente a todas las necesidades. Sin embargo, puede servir como guía o punto de partida para llegar al resultado deseado en el desarrollo de software.
  • Documentación: En muchas ocasiones, la documentación es pasada por alto durante el proceso de desarrollo o la creación de una API. Aquí es donde ChatGPT puede desempeñar un papel fundamental al ayudarnos a generar un esquema inicial de documentación que luego podemos personalizar según nuestras necesidades específicas.
  • Resolución de problemas: A menudo, los desarrolladores dedican más tiempo a investigar la solución de un problema que a implementarla. En este sentido, ChatGPT puede ser una valiosa fuente de orientación al proporcionar contexto y sugerencias para resolver problemas técnicos.

Como se puede apreciar, ChatGPT puede satisfacer tres necesidades fundamentales que los desarrolladores enfrentan en su día a día. Es importante destacar que estas son solo algunas de las funciones más destacadas, ya que profundizar en este tema podría revelar una lista aún más amplia de aplicaciones. Esto demuestra que la inteligencia artificial no debe ser vista como una amenaza para el empleo, sino como una herramienta que puede extender y mejorar nuestras capacidades, tanto en el ámbito laboral como en nuestra vida cotidiana. Lo esencial es aprender a utilizarla de manera efectiva para obtener el máximo beneficio de esta tecnología.

particula_mas_naranja particula_circulo_naranja particula_mas_grande_naranja particula_circulo_2_naranja

$blog->img

¿BackEnd, FrontEnd, BackOffice y por qué son importantes?

Al iniciar con propuestas para algún desarrollo web, pueden surgir algunos términos de los que no hemos escuchado hablar y suelen ser muy importantes para familiarizarte con el proceso del desarrollo, tales como Backend, Frontend,  BackOffice y Fr...

Ver más flechita_negra

$blog->img

¿Qué es Ionic y por qué usarlo en el desarrollo de apps móviles?

¿Qué es IONIC? IONIC es un framework de desarrollo que se está haciendo muy popular últimamente.  Es una herramienta que los programadores pueden utilizar totalmente gratis, para desarrollar apps basadas en HTML5, CSS, JavaScript y utiliza Typ...

Ver más flechita_negra

$blog->img

¿Qué es un desarrollador Full Stack?

Un desarrollador Full Stack es el encargado de manejar cada uno de los aspectos relacionados con la creación y el mantenimiento de un sistema web o una app. Para ello es fundamental que el desarrollador Full Stack tenga conocimientos en desarrollo F...

Ver más flechita_negra

Puntos blancos

Cuéntanos sobre tu proyecto particula_mas particula_circulo particula_mas_grande particula_circulo_2